#45321f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#45321f is composed of 27.1% red, 19.6% green and 12.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.5% magenta, 55.1% yellow and 72.9% black. It has a hue angle of 30 degrees, a saturation of 38% and a lightness of 19.6%. #45321f color hex could be obtained by blending #8a643e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#45321f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#45321f has RGB values of R:69, G:50, B:31 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.55,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 4534815.

Shades and Tints of #45321f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#faf6f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#45321f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#36322e is the less saturated color, while #643200 is the most saturated one.
